Output 81ed53a5c294df102c2efa3f23f0264a19e8750a4bfd97d629a2f21606ad4956:0

value
58559580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0a96312fbae94ae7d044854773386f77d7a7602 OP_EQUAL
address
3PdX1oHAtN7hvv1PNm3kAbwLZCvEdXcFLq
transaction
81ed53a5c294df102c2efa3f23f0264a19e8750a4bfd97d629a2f21606ad4956
spent
true